    BID Services is working with StreetGames to create new opportunities for young deaf people to take part in organised sport. StreetGames is a national agency that works to develop sporting opportunities for young people aged 8 to 19, usually those who live in disadvantaged areas and who are currently experiencing one or more disabilities.

    BID Services is working with an EU consortium led by Nottingham Trent University, to develop a series of contemporary serious games called Game on Extra Time. The games are designed to help those with a sensory, physical or mental impairment improve their skills and work towards a more independent lifestyle.
